Ribbons for Peace




Marble Collegiate Church, Manhattan. Prayers for Peace.
These Ribbons have been hung on this fence since the 3rd anniversary of the US attacking Iraq in March, 2003.

Gold ribbons represent prayers for the families and friends of the service people who have lost their lives. As people die, more ribbons are added.

Blue ribbons represent prayers for those in Iraq, for the families and friends of the Iraqis who have lost their lives and for all who have been wounded.

Green ribbons represent prayers for peace.

“The toll of human pain and suffering is impossible to measure.” I read these words are on a plague displayed behind the fence, along with a statue of Norman Vincent Peale, “Minister of this Church from 1932 –1984.”
